Building foundation repair services focus on restoring the stability and integrity of a structure’s base. These services typically involve assessing the existing foundation, identifying iss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and then implementing appropriate repair techniques. Common methods include underpinning, slab jacking, or pier installation, all aimed at reinforcing the foundation to prevent further damage and ensure safety. Skilled professionals use specialized equipment and materials to address foundation concerns effectively, helping property owners maintain a solid and secure building.
Foundation problems can lead to a range of issues within a property. Signs of trouble often include u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. If left unaddressed, these issues can worsen over time, leading to more extensive and costly repairs. Building foundation repair services help solve these problems by stabilizing the structure, preventing further movement, and reducing the risk of structural failure. This proactive approach can save property owners from significant damage and the associated expenses.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For minor cracks, expenses may be closer to $2,000, while significant structural repairs can exceed $10,000.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on the size of the foundation, soil conditions, and accessibility. For example, repairing a small slab in Fort Myers Beach might cost around $3,000, whereas a larger basement foundation could reach $15,000 or more.
Average Price Range - On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$4,000 and $10,000 for comprehensive foundation repair services. This includes assessments, repairs, and stabilization work performed by local contractors.
Cost Considerations - Additional expenses may include soil stabilization, waterproofing, or underpinning, which can increase the overall cost. Contact local pros to obtain accurate estimates tailored to specific foundation issues and property conditions.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include underpinning, pier installation, mudjacking, and crack injection, among others, depending on the specific issue.
What causes foundation issues in homes? Common causes include soil settlement or shifting, poor drainage, tree roots, and changes in moisture levels around the property.
